Front

What is diction?

Back

Diction refers to word choice and its impact on tone.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does tone mean in literature?

Back

Tone is the author's attitude toward the subject, conveyed through word choice and style.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How can diction affect tone?

Back

Diction can create a specific tone by using words that evoke certain emotions or attitudes.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the definition of syntax?

Back

Syntax is the arrangement of words and phrases to create well-formed sentences.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How does syntax influence meaning?

Back

Syntax can change the meaning of a sentence by altering the order of words.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an example of passionate diction?

Back

Using strong, emotive words like 'devastated' or 'ecstatic' to convey deep feelings.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is euphemistic diction?

Back

Euphemistic diction uses polite or mild expressions to replace harsh or blunt ones.
